Understanding the Basics of Dental Insurance

Dental insurance plans can vary widely, but most offer coverage for a range of services. Understanding these can help you choose a plan that best suits your needs:

  • Preventive Care: Most plans cover the cost of preventive services such as regular check-ups, cleanings, and X-rays. This encourages individuals to maintain regular dental visits, which can prevent more serious issues down the road.
  • Basic Procedures: Fillings, extractions, and periodontal treatments are often partially covered under dental insurance plans.
  • Major Procedures: Some plans contribute to more complex procedures like crowns, bridges, and dentures, though typically at a lower coverage rate.

Financial Security and Cost Management

One of the primary benefits of dental insurance is the financial security it provides:

  • Cost Predictability: Knowing what is covered and the extent of coverage allows for better financial planning and budgeting.
  • Reduced Out-of-Pocket Expenses: Insurance coverage can significantly lower the amount paid directly by the patient for dental procedures.
  • Access to Networks: Many insurance plans have a network of preferred providers that offer services at reduced rates.

Choosing the Right Dental Insurance Plan

Selecting the appropriate dental insurance plan involves careful consideration of various factors:

  • Coverage Needs: Identify which services are most important based on personal dental history and potential future needs.
  • Cost and Premiums: Balance the cost of premiums with the level of coverage provided.
  • Provider Networks: Check if preferred dentists are within the plan?s network to ensure continuity of care.
